Foreclosure Team Lead salary in Latvia

Average Yearly Salary of Foreclosure Team Lead in Latvia is approximately 17,767 EUR (17,762 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Foreclosure Team Lead do?

occupation personasA foreclosure team lead is responsible for overseeing a team of professionals involved in the foreclosure process. They work closely with attorneys, loan officers, and other stakeholders to ensure compliance with legal requirements and company policies. The team lead manages the day-to-day operations, including reviewing foreclosure files, coordinating court appearances, and communicating with borrowers. They provide guidance and support to team members, ensuring efficient workflow and timely completion of tasks. Additionally, they may be involved in training and mentoring new team members, monitoring performance metrics, and implementing process improvements.
